    Hey everyone. I’ve have a great 3d track going in one action node within batch. I’ve created some frames on the back wall and they’re moving nicely with the track I’ve gotten. What I need to do now is comp in the talent who passes in front of the frames. I know I can do the composite in an additional node but what I want to know is there a way to do it within the same node where the 3d tracking is going on? Because I’m using the Camera1 output, it puts my masked in talent into the 3d space. Can I do it in one Action or do I need to always feed it to another node to do the final composite? Thanks guys.

    Make the live action footage a child of the camera and move it in Z (and possibly scale it if you need to keep your z-buffer on and can’t push it back without going through your other images) until the image node’s borders line up with the action’s borders. Since the image is hanging off the camera track it won’t be affected by the moving camera.
